The traditional way to develop a psychographic segmentation model has been through a market research study surveying a statistically representative sample of a target audience. The Elliott wave principle, or Elliott wave theory, is a form of technical analysis that helps financial traders analyze market cycles and forecast market trends by identifying extremes in investor psychology and price levels, such as highs and lows, by looking for patterns in prices.
